Alenka Bratušek
Alenka Bratušek is a Slovenian politician and the Minister of Infrastructure. She has played a significant role in managing transportation policies and infrastructure developments in Slovenia, particularly focusing on improving road safety and efficiency amidst ongoing construction projects.
Born on Mar 01, 1970 (56 years old)
